13 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Simmer'

The pot began to simmer as the chef prepared the flavorful broth.

After the argument, a tense silence settled in the room, allowing emotions to simmer.

The simmering anticipation in the stadium reached its peak as the final moments of the game approached.

The detective let the information simmer in his mind, searching for the missing puzzle pieces.

The music played softly, creating a simmering ambiance in the cozy jazz club.

As the novel reached its climax, the author allowed the tension to simmer before the resolution.

The simmering discontent among the citizens prompted a call for social change.

After adding the spices, let the curry simmer for a while to enhance the flavors.

The heated discussion began to simmer down as people started listening to each other.

The political tension continued to simmer, raising concerns among the citizens.

Allow the tea to simmer gently, ensuring it reaches the perfect temperature for a rich flavor.

The rivalry between the two teams continued to simmer, adding excitement to the game.

The economic issues began to simmer, prompting discussions among experts and policymakers.
